Patent:  Immunological methods for treating schizophrenia

Patent No:  5,037,645

Inventor:  Strahilevitz; Meir

Abstract

Immunoassays of psychoactive drugs including psychotomimetic drugs, narcotic drugs, and tetrahydrocannabinols and treatment methods based on the antigenic properties of protein conjugates of these drugs. These methods are based upon treating the psychoactive substances as haptens and utilizing their protein conjugates to produce antibodies to the psychoactive materials themselves. The immunoassay methods include both agglutination and agglutination-inhibition reactions. The treatment methods include treatment of both exogenous, administered drugs (such as cannabinols, LSD, heroin and morphine) and endogenous substances (such as N,N-Dimethyltryptamine and 5-Methoxy-N,N-Dimethyltryptamine, by active immunization and also passive immunization.

Claims

Having thus described the invention, what is claimed and desired to be secured by Letters Patent is:

1. A method of treating schizophrenia in a human, said method comprising administering to said human an antibody to a species which is etiological to schizophrenia.

2. The method of claim 1 wherein said species is a psychoactive indoleamine.

3. The method of claim 1 wherein said antibody comprises in vitro prepared fragments of an antibody produced in vivo in a suitable animal.

4. The method of claim 1 wherein said species is an enzyme.

5. The method of claim 4 wherein said enzyme catalyzes a reaction in the metabolism of a psychoactive indoleamine.

6. The method of claim 1 wherein said antibody comprises at least one immunologically active part of a complete antibody.

7. A method of treating a mental illness in a human, the etiology of said mental illness comprising endogenous production of a psychoactive hapten, said method comprising administering to said human an antibody to said hapten or to an enzyme which catalyzes a reaction in the metabolism of the hapten.

8. The method of claim 7 wherein said antibody comprises at least one immunologically active part of a complete antibody.
